Janelle Monae - Live from Texas

Posted by Ezra Ace Caraeff on Thu, Mar 26, 2009 at 11:04 AM

Our love affair with the space age music of Janelle Monae is pretty well documented, but we'll never miss an opportunity to lobby for this superstar in the making.

Monae's limited output (an EP, plus some tracks from a Big Boi mix) is trumped by her redonkulous live show, one that somehow melds the usually shameful world of backing tracks with a furious live band. Her guitarist, the dapper gent that the Fader lovingly referred to as "Captain Shreddington," might be the only musician talented enough to pry some of the spotlight away from the pintsize ball of energy that is Monae. Watching this video makes me wish more bands put so much effort in their live performances.

Plus it makes me want to purchase a bow tie.
